In 1850 Thomas Tilling started horse bus services, and in 1855 the
London General Omnibus Company or LGOC was founded to amalgamate and
regulate the horse-drawn omnibus conveniences then operating in London.
In 1912 the Underground Group, which at that time owned mainly of the
London Underground, bought the LGOC.
